Cytotoxic effect of Hemidesmus indicus R. Br. on HCT 116 human colon cell lines

Author(s):
Nutan, Nitin Kumar and Gaurav Saxena
Abstract:
Mammalian tumour cells display resistance to chemotherapy and its severe side effects diminishes the clinical usefulness of a huge variety of anticancer agents. Plant-derived compounds manifest many beneficial effects, furthermore be able to probably inhibit several stages of cancer. In the present study, we endeavored to take advantage of bioactive compounds of Hemidesmus indicus, so we investigated their antioxidant and antiproliferative properties on colon cancer cell lines HCT116. The preliminary phytochemical screening of ethanolic extract showed the presence of significant secondary metabolites. Our findings infer that the potential bioactive compounds of plant has significantly inhibited the growth of colon cancer cells and its extract can be applied as adjuvant medicines in combination regular chemotherapeutic agents.
